The question of Satoshi net worth arises from the fact that the creator of Bitcoin mined or received a significant amount of coins in the earliest days of the network. As the mysterious founder, Satoshi Nakamoto is believed to have accumulated a large portion of the initial supply before anyone else was mining, making their holdings extremely valuable once Bitcoin started to appreciate.
Estimating Satoshi net worth
Most estimates of Satoshi net worth rely on tracking the Bitcoin addresses believed to be controlled by the creator, primarily those that received the original block rewards from the early mined blocks. Analysts look at the movement of these coins and apply current market prices to arrive at a rough valuation, but these calculations are highly theoretical and depend entirely on Bitcoin’s volatile price.
Because Bitcoin’s price can swing dramatically in short periods, any reported Satoshi net worth figure can change overnight. Some calculations place the value in the billions during bull runs, while corrections in the market can quickly reduce that number by a significant margin.
The mystery behind the holdings
Satoshi Nakamoto’s identity is unknown, and this anonymity adds another layer of complexity when discussing net worth. Without confirmation that a specific person or group is Satoshi, any valuation is essentially an educated guess based on blockchain analysis rather than confirmed financial data.
The lack of transparency means that even if coins are moved, it is difficult to prove that Satoshi is involved. This uncertainty makes it impossible to state with certainty whether the coins are still owned, lost, or being held for future use.
Lost or untouched coins
Many in the cryptocurrency community believe that the early mined coins associated with Satoshi may be lost forever. If this is true, the net worth attributed to those coins has no practical value because they cannot be accessed or sold, turning a large theoretical number into an academic concept rather than real wealth.
